Moscow approved economic zone in Murmansk

An economic zone in Murmansk will be introduced in three stages, regional Governor Dmitri Dmitriyenko says.

The federal government has approved the establishment of a special economic zone in the port of Murmansk, Governor Dmitriyenko confirmed after meetings in Moscow this week.

The development of the zone will be made in three phases, which eventually will boost the port’s trade turnover to more than 100 million tons by year 2025, a press release from the regional government reads. The plans includes the construction of a railway to the western side of the Kola Bay.

-This is a very important decision made by the federal government, Dmitriyenko underlines. –It will give a serious new development impulse for Murmansk Oblast, he adds.

The development of the port zone is estimated to create about 3000 new jobs, stimulate investor conditions and boost regional tax revenues to more than 40 billion RUB, the governor says.
